Product Description

Ultra Hi-Float Balloon Treatment is a liquid plastic solution that coats the inside of your balloons and holds in helium longer.

I bought this stuff to use on the balloons I'm doing for my lovely other half's 50th birthday do.Hi-Float is a thick gelatinous plastic solution contained in a pump action bottle. You are advised to place the neck of your balloon over the spout and pump some solution into the balloon. This will enable your Helium balloon to stay afloat longer!Or will it?. . .I've tested it out :)I used some of the balloons I've bought for the party and they are good quality latex.I checked the MSDS (material safety data sheet) info out for this stuff and it appears pretty safe chemical-wise and non hazardous to humans. The main ingredients are-water, polyvynil alcohol and dextrose monohydrate.I filled one balloon with the treatment like so. . .put the nozzle as deep inside the balloon as possible so as to keep the neck dry, it could drip out and cover your helium gas bottle valve whilst filling with gas and your hands. Once in the balloon you are advised to rub the bulb part of the balloon around to spread the gel inside. You have to pinch the neck of the balloon as you remove the nozzle to clean the nozzle into the balloon and so non drips out. Then fill your balloon with helium. Now handtie your balloon. Helium balloon valves are no good with this stuff at all. now your balloon is done.I tested this against another balloon which I prepared like so. . .I filled it with Helium and tied it off! :)Err. . .12 hours later both were still up and 16 hours later the helium only one was still up and the treated one was erm. . .err. . .ooo. . .mmm. . . .down!
